AAWG WDM 40ch Gaussian Type
What are the advantages of AAWG WDM?
With the vigorous development of 5G, users will have higher and higher requirements for bandwidth. Operators will need to continuously increase data transmission rates, increase transmission capacity, and reduce operating costs. Among them, the active WDM-PON solution is difficult to deploy on a large scale due to its high cost; while the passive WDM-PON will have more application space due to its advantages of low cost, no power supply, and easy installation. Among them, the non-thermal AWG will be more widely used because of its larger number of channels, denser channel spacing, and no need to rely on power supply or temperature control.
Athermal AWG WDM, also known as Athermal Arrayed Waveguide Grating WDM and AAWG WDM Splitter, along with FBT WDM splitter, LAN WDM splitter, Filter WDM splitter, dense WDM splitter and coarse WDM splitter, are the most commonly used WDM device in construction of PON.
Product Information:
AAWG Gaussian type module, which is based on Silicon PLC optical grating technology, is dense wavelength division multiplexing, using athermal configuration, no need to control the temperature of chip, with low insertion loss, high capacity, stable reliability
Product Features:
- High number of channels
- High Stability and reliability
- High isolation,low insertion loss
Product Specification:
- Numbers of Channel: 40
- Pass band wavelength (nm): ITU standard
- Offset of Central wavelength (nm): ±0.05
- Spacing (GHz): 100
- 1 dB Bandwidth (nm): 0.22
- 3 dB Bandwidth (nm): 0.42
- Insertion Loss (dB): Maximum 3.5
- Flatness (dB): Maximum 1.5
- Uniformity (dB) @ITU CW: Maximum 1.3
- Adjacent Channel Isolation (dB): Minimum 27
- Non-Adjacent, Channel Isolation (dB): Minimum 30
- Return Loss (dB) (with conn.): Minimum 40
- PDL (dB): Maximum 0.50
- PDM (ps): Maximum 0.50
- Maximum Optical Power (mW): 300
- Operating Temperature Range (℃): -40~85
- Storage Temperature Range (℃): -40~85
- Fiber Type: Corning SMF 28e+ or equal(or customized)
- Fiber Length (m): ≥1.0(or customized)
- Package dimension (mm) Max: 150x70x12 or customized
